SRS components are located in this area. Review the SRS component locations, precautions, and procedures in the SRS section (24) before performing repairs or service.
- Remove the driver's dashboard lower cover and knee bolster (see DASHBOARD COMPONENT REMOVAL/INSTALLATION ).
- Disconnect the 10P connector from the integrated control unit.
- Remove the integrated control unit from the under-dash fuse/relay box.
- Inspect the connector and socket terminals to be sure they are all making good contact.
- If the terminals are bent, loose or corroded, repair them as necessary, and recheck the system.
- If the terminals look OK, make the following input tests at the connector and the fuse/relay box socket.
- If any test indicates a problem, find and correct the cause, then recheck the system.
- If all the input tests prove OK, the control unit must be faulty; replace it.
All Systems:
TEST CONDITION CHART
| Cavity | Wire | Test condition | Test: Desired result | Possible cause if result is not obtained |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| A14 | BLK | Under all conditions | Check for continuity to ground: There should be continuity. |

| A9 | Fuse/relay box socket | Under all conditions | Check for voltage to ground: There should be battery voltage. |

| A6 | Fuse/relay box socket | Ignition switch ON (II) | Check for voltage to ground: There should be battery voltage. |

Intermittent Wiper System:
TEST CONDITION CHART
| Cavity | Wire | Test condition | Test: Desired result | Possible cause if result is not obtained |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| B1 | BLU/BLK | Ignition switch ON (II), and windshield wiper switch at OFF or INT | Check for voltage to ground: There should be battery voltage. |

| B3 | YEL/BLU | Ignition switch ON (II), and windshield wiper switch at INT | Check for voltage to ground: There should be battery voltage. |

| B4 | WHT/BLK | Ignition switch ON (II), and windshield washer switch ON | Check for voltage to ground: There should be battery voltage. |

Key-in/Seat Belt Reminder, Lights-on Reminder System:
TEST CONDITION CHART
| Cavity | Wire | Test condition | Test: Desired result | Possible cause if result is not obtained |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| A8 | Fuse/relay box socket | Combination light switch ON | Check for voltage to ground: There should be battery voltage. |

| B7 | RED/BLU | Ignition switch ON (II), and driver's seat belt switch unbuckled | Check for voltage to ground: There should be 1 V or less. |

| B9 | GRN | Driver's door open | Check for voltage to ground: There should be 1 V or less. |

| B10 | BLU/RED | Ignition key inserted into the ignition key switch | Check for voltage to ground: There should be 1 V or less. |

Bulb Check System (Brake System Light):
TEST CONDITION CHART
| Cavity | Wire | Test condition | Test: Desired result | Possible cause if result is not obtained |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| A4 | Fuse/relay box socket | Ignition switch ON (II), brake fluid reservoir full, and parking brake lever down | Connect to ground: Brake system light should come on. |

| A13 | Fuse/relay box socket | Ignition switch at START (III) | Check for voltage to ground: There should be battery voltage. |
